• 06.09.11:: Orlando Tech’s Youngest Students
On June 9, 2011 Orlando Tech's youngest students completed their school year in the Orange County Head Start program located at Orlando Tech.
Seventeen children have enjoyed growing and exploring in the spacious classroom and outdoor learning environment under the leadership of Ms. Gladys Arzon and Ms. Maureen Roberson.
